WELCOME W

elcome to all our first-timers, and welcome back to all our regulars! It’s almost that time of year again, the second Sunday in October, Wells Food Festival Day, which this year falls on Sunday, October 10. Now in our ninth year, our team of volunteers have once again put together a superb and diverse celebration of local artisan food and drink. After a really challenging year for many of our producers, we look forward to delivering another successful Festival for them and our visitors. This year nearly 200 stalls will be there to showcase and sell their culinary delights. We are delighted that nearly all of our regular stallholders will be returning, as well as some really interesting newcomers for you to discover, all selected by us to offer you the widest possible variety of tastes and ideas. We’re so lucky in Somerset to be surrounded by such quality, such talent and such inventiveness. And it’s all here for you. New for 2021 we are pleased to introduce an area specifically for artisan producers from Beyond Somerset, many of which traded with us at our virtual festival last year; a feature area celebrating English Wine; and for our younger visitors, Fun Kitchen free cookery sessions. As always, entry is free. There’s so much to see, so why not make a day of it? We’ve arranged plenty of places for you to take the weight off your feet. Welcome to the city of Wells, everyone. Have a terrific day!

INTRODUCTION

>>

Our History None of us could have imagined, back in 2012, that what started out as a Great Somerset Sunday Lunch, with a handful of stalls, would become so large, so diverse, and so popular that the Daily Telegraph chose us as one of Europe’s best food festivals. Nine years on, Wells Food Festival is firmly established in the Somerset calendar – back in 2019 (our last live festival) despite the downpours more than 10,000 visitors arrived to enjoy the food and drink stalls, all set in the extraordinary surroundings of England’s smallest city. In the early days, it was confined to the medieval Market Place, but now the Festival has expanded into the Town Hall, continues onto the Bishop’s Palace Green along the Palace Moat Walk, and into the Recreation Ground and Bishop’s Barn. A tiny team of less than 10 volunteers have dedicated their time over the last few months to arrange this year’s festival

wellsfoodfestival.co.uk

– booking and locating stallholders, marquees, electrics, safety equipment, recruiting stewards, seeking the sponsorship we need just to break even, arranging insurance, rubbish disposal… the list goes on. A mountain of work full of tiny details. But as they say, it’s worth it – if you have a great day, we do too. Still crazy after all these years.

Our Purpose From the very start, we have stuck firmly to our prime aim: to showcase and celebrate the high-quality work of our county’s artisan food and drink producers and manufacturers. By attracting such a large audience, we are proud to play our part in boosting our stallholders’ businesses, the local economy, the city’s prestige and the tourism on which the whole area depends. And, we hope to give each of our visitors a fulfilling day, packed with flavour, surprises, fun and learning.

MAP 1. MARKET PLACE

Taste your way around the Market Place and enjoy a mix of local artisan traders and street food stalls selling culinary delights. Take some time out at the covered seating area and enjoy sampling local beer and cider.

2. TOWN HALL

The Town Hall hosts local artisan crafts and produce, including hand-crafted wooden products, candles and jewellery, ceramics and much more.

3. MARKET PLACE MARQUEE

In the Lodestone Marquee you will be treated to array of artisan delights, from awardwinning charcuterie and local cheese to marshmallows.

4. RECREATION GROUND

The Truespeed Marquee will be bursting with more artisan producers selling locally produced culinary treats. Outside of the marquee more foodie delights await. You can sample locally made sausage rolls and delicious Street Food, visit the Clear Space seating area and sample more local ciders and beers. On the bandstand a full programme of music will keep you entertained throughout the day.

5. CHILDREN’S AREA

Located in the Bishop’s Barn, Noah’s Ark Pre-School will be providing interactive fun for our younger visitors.

6. MOAT WALK

Enjoy a stroll along the moat, savour the beauty of your surroundings and enjoy meeting more artisan producers and delicious street food.

7. BEYOND SOMERSET

A new area to the festival welcoming a selection of South West Artisan food and drink producers from beyond Somerset.

8. PALACE GREEN

On the beautiful Palace Green, stroll and enjoy a further mix of artisan producers, a delightful array of beverages and tasty street food.

9. CELEBRATION OF ENGLISH WINE

New for 2021 is an area celebrating English wines. Ben Franks of Novel wine will host three exclusive tasting sessions. To book your tickets visit wellsfoodfestival.co.uk/wine-tastings

10. FUN KITCHEN

Fun Kitchen is an award-winning pop-up cookery school bringing fab food fun to the festival’s younger visitors. Children will have a chance to create their own Apple Scone Bread Twist. The sessions are free and children from 3+ are welcome. Come along to the Fun Kitchen marquee to sign up for a session on the day.

WHAT’S ON

There’s much more to the Food Festival than just the stalls. Here’s a taster of some of the other things to sample on the day

Beyond Somerset

The Children’s Trail

Last year’s virtual festival enabled us to broaden our reach beyond Somerset and invite producers from across the South West. This extension to the festival is being brought to life in a new area with a selection of regional artisan food and drink makers that complement those appearing in the Artisan Market.

Mogers Drewett is proudly supporting the Children’s Trail at this year’s Festival. For a fun way to see the festival, join the interactive trail and learn some great local foodie facts as you go! Collect your trail map (complete with clues) at the entrance or from the Wells Food Festival Stand and you’re ready to start your journey of food discovery. There are two trails available – a picture trail for little ones and a quiz trail for the slightly older kids. Both trails will take you all around the festival, with clues hidden in each of the main areas. There will be a small prize available for all correctly completed trail sheets at the end of the trail (from where you collected the Trail Map).

A Celebration of English Wine New for 2021 is a feature area celebrating the quality wine produced in England. Local vineyards will be represented alongside those from further afield. Ben Franks, of Novel Wine in Bath, will be sharing his passion for English wine with three exclusive tasting sessions during the day. The themes are: Bacchus wine from different regions, a wine and food pairing, and English fizz. For more details and to book your space at a tasting session visit our website at wellsfoodfestival.co.uk

Town Hall The lower floor of the Town Hall hosts local artisan crafts and produce. Knife sharpeners to candles, local jams and chutneys to beeswax covers, and hand-crafted wooden products all make an appearance.

Fun Kitchen Fun Kitchen is an award-winning pop-up cookery school that brings fab food fun to children and young people at food festivals, county shows and both primary and secondary schools nationwide. Fun Kitchen delivers hands-on cookery workshops using seasonal ingredients and produce to make traditional recipes with a twist! Simon and his Fun Kitchen team travel the country wowing kids with their unique and explosive approach to food education – they have been known to blow up food to demonstrate the science behind what we eat! Simon’s passion is food; he is a trained chef and a qualified secondary school food teacher. He runs Fun Kitchen and manages many other food-related projects which support food teachers in schools across the country to help get the next generation hands-on with their food and learn where it comes from. wellsfoodfestival.co.uk Simon lives locally and he is especially

excited to bring Fun Kitchen to the Wells Food Festival where he will be setting up his mobile kitchen to cook up Apple and Cinnamon Scone Bread Twists with the young visitors to the festival. There are four sessions available: 11:00 – 11.45 12:00 – 12.45 14:00 – 14:45 15:00 – 15:45 Chef ’s hats and aprons will be provided to wear in the workshop and ingredients will be provided. This activity is suitable for children and young people aged 3+ This activity is free of charge and will prove to be very popular. Numbers are strictly limited so head over to Fun Kitchen first thing on the day to book your session and avoid any disappointment.
